Bookkeeping Services: The Heart of Every Financial Operation
Every financial decision starts with accurate records. Whether you're a solo entrepreneur, small business, or nonprofit, quality bookkeeping services are essential.
What Do Bookkeeping Services Include?
- Recording daily financial transactions
- Reconciling bank statements
- Generating financial reports (P&L, balance sheet, cash flow)
- Managing accounts receivable and payable
- Payroll processing
- Preparing documents for tax season
Using professional bookkeeping services ensures you have a clear picture of your financial health, helping you make informed decisions and plan for the future.
Specialized Church Bookkeeping Services: Faith and Finances in Harmony
Churches and faith-based organizations have unique financial needs. Their income streams come from donations, tithes, and grants, while expenses can include mission work, payroll, and facilities management. This makes specialized church bookkeeping services essential.
Why Churches Need Specialized Bookkeeping Services
- Fund Accounting: Track designated donations separately.
- Transparency: Maintain trust with your congregation by showing responsible stewardship.
- Compliance: Stay aligned with IRS guidelines for nonprofit organizations.
- Reporting: Create detailed reports for the board, donors, and audits.
- Payroll for Clergy: Navigate clergy-specific tax rules and housing allowances.
Using an online bookkeeping service that understands the intricacies of church finances ensures you're managing your resources with integrity and precision.
